Fault Codes:Caterpillar General SPN582
What is Caterpillar Fault Code SPN582?
SPN582 indicates a malfunction in the Implement Pump Solenoid Valve Circuit, specifically detecting an abnormal electrical current or voltage condition in the hydraulic pump control system. This Suspect Parameter Number (SPN) is part of the J1939 diagnostic protocol used across Caterpillar excavators and signals that the Engine Control Module (ECM) has detected an open circuit, short circuit, or incorrect resistance in the solenoid that regulates hydraulic pump output.
This code is critical because the implement pump solenoid directly controls hydraulic flow to the excavator's attachments—boom, stick, bucket, and auxiliary circuits. When this circuit fails, the machine cannot properly modulate hydraulic pressure, leading to reduced performance or complete loss of implement functions. On used Caterpillar excavators, this fault often stems from electrical degradation rather than mechanical failure.
Common Symptoms
- Reduced hydraulic responsiveness or sluggish attachment movements, particularly during simultaneous functions
- Implement pump derate mode, where the excavator limits hydraulic output to prevent damage
- Amber warning light on the instrument cluster with SPN582 displayed on the monitor
- Intermittent loss of auxiliary hydraulic functions while main boom/stick operations remain functional
- Erratic hydraulic pressure fluctuations during operation, especially under heavy loads
Potential Causes
The most common triggers for SPN582 on used Caterpillar excavators include:
- Damaged wiring harness at rub points near the pump mounting area where vibration causes insulation wear
- Corroded or moisture-contaminated connectors at the solenoid valve, extremely common in machines operating in wet conditions
- Failed implement pump solenoid valve due to internal coil breakdown (typically 8-12 ohms resistance when functional)
- Faulty ECM relay or power supply issue providing incorrect voltage to the solenoid circuit
- ECM internal driver circuit failure, though less common than field-level electrical issues
- Aftermarket harness repairs using incompatible wire gauge or inadequate sealing
How to Troubleshoot and Fix Code SPN582
Step 1: Visual Inspection and Connector Check Begin by locating the implement pump solenoid valve on the main hydraulic pump assembly. Disconnect the electrical connector and inspect for corrosion, bent pins, or moisture intrusion. On used excavators, check the wiring harness routing for worn insulation at frame contact points—particularly where harnesses pass near the swing bearing or pump mounting brackets.
Step 2: Solenoid Resistance Testing Using a digital multimeter, measure resistance across the solenoid coil terminals (connector disconnected, key off). Caterpillar specifications typically call for 8-12 ohms. Readings outside this range indicate solenoid failure. Also check for continuity to ground—there should be infinite resistance between each terminal and the valve body.
Step 3: Circuit Voltage and ECM Output Test Reconnect the harness and back-probe the connector using a multimeter or Cat ET diagnostic software. With the key on, verify the ECM supplies proper voltage (typically 12-24V depending on model). Command the solenoid active using Cat Electronic Technician software and observe voltage drop—sluggish response indicates high resistance in the circuit. Check harness continuity from the ECM connector to the solenoid.
Step 4: Repair or Replace Components Replace corroded connectors using OEM sealed connectors with dielectric grease. If wiring is damaged, repair using equivalent gauge wire (typically 18-20 AWG) with heat-shrink solder connections—avoid crimp connectors in high-vibration areas. Replace the solenoid valve if resistance testing failed. Clear codes with diagnostic software and perform a hydraulic function test.
Disclaimer: This guide provides general troubleshooting steps for SPN582. Always consult the specific Caterpillar service manual for your excavator model and serial number. For used machines with complex electrical issues or ECM-related faults, professional diagnosis with factory-level diagnostic tools is recommended to avoid unnecessary parts replacement.
Fault Description:
Axle weight
Fault Cause:
SPN (Suspicious Parameter Number) : FMI is used in conjunction with SPN to provide specific information related to the Fault Diagnosis Code (DTC). The FMI may indicate faults in circuits or electrical components that have been detected before. FMI may also indicate the abnormal operation conditions that have been detected before. This code is displayed in the form of "SPN-FMI". The ECM/ECU also attaches the textual description to the information transmitted through the J1939 data link. This text description is used to describe SPN-FMI. Determine the failure mode of the DTC by evaluating the electrical signals of the suspicious circuit. Failure mode identifiers can be divided into two types: A code indicating a detected fault in a circuit or electrical component 258. The code indicating system events was detected Usually, when the signal of the circuit exceeds the range of the sensor, the first type of code is generated. The code of the second category indicates that the sensor signal is normal, but the signal exceeds the normal working range of the parameters. Please refer to the troubleshooting guide for the specific product. The troubleshooting guide steps will help determine the root cause of the DTC
FairTradeMachinery
You Design the Vision. We Handle the Hard Parts.
Helping Global Buyers Access Better-Value Machinery and After-Sales Solutions.
As China's Leading Global Used Machinery Exchange Platform, we sits at the intersection of IoT technology and B2B commerce. That means real-time inventory data, verified seller profiles, and a transaction process designed for cross-border buyers who can't always inspect machines in person. Our users in China have exceeded 1.5 millions meaning we have the first source of excavator owners and the equivalent number of machines. This means we can cover all the popular models and even specific needs, no matter of the status.







FAQs
WhatsApp